Foo Fighters fans are pretty hardcore. Remember that time they successfully crowdfunded the Foo Fighters’ return to Richmond? Then there was that video last year of an Italian man asking for 1,000 people to come together and perform a cover of “Learn To Fly” by the Foo Fighters in hopes of catching Dave Grohl’s attention. Amazingly, he did it. 1,000 ecstatic fans from around Italy came together, jammed in synchronization, and possibly broke a Guinness World Record, all to ask the band to play in the small northern Italian town Cesena. Now we just have to wait and see if the Foo Fighters will respond. Watch the jam session below.

UPDATE: In a post on their official website, the Foos comment, “Che bello, Cesena….” which translates to “How beautiful, Cesena.” Now, this doesn’t mean they’re agreeing to play a concert there, but it’s something.

UPDATE 2: Now they’ve tweeted, “Ci vediamo a presto, Cesena…. xxx Davide” which translates to “See you soon, David.”
